Pokedex Data

  • Type: Electric
  • Resistances: Electric, Flying, Steel
  • Weaknesses: Ground
  • Scarlet Entry: The extension and contraction of its muscles generates electricity. It glows when in trouble.

How to evolve Shinx

Shinx evolves into Luxio at level 15 and then into Luxray at level 30.
